Fires across Australia East Coast

Multiple fires dotted Australia’s Gold Coast on September 9, 2003. Most of the fires, represented by red squares, follow the green line of ridges that make up the Great Dividing Range along the continent’s southeast coast. In the top right corner, Fraser Island juts into the Coral Sea. Bright blue-green circles to the north are part of the Bunker Group, a coral reef just south of the southern fringes of the Great Barrier Reef.
